I'm using a melee rogue with double daggers and have been upgrading them as I lvl up. Is this a good approach or would I be better off saving the materials for later on and using the weapons as-is?

Keep upgrading.

As you level up, you will throwing out old item. However, max out item help you climb level and questing faster.

Don't worry about resources. You will have a ton of gold "trash" later on. Each time you kill boss, participate in world map event, it throw one or two gold item. Most of gold item are weaker than what you have. So, break them for materials.

Starting at about level 20, I always upgrade my weapons up to the third level (the first three upgrade levels only require common components). The fourth level requires more rare components which I want to preserve for the endgame.
